A man has been seriously injured after a massive explosion at a business in Sydney’s western suburbs.

Emergency services rushed to the scene at Wetherill Park just after 10.30am on Monday where a man was treated on scene for serious leg injuries.

Police units and multiple ambulance crews arrived at find a business on Cowpasture Rd alight after reports of an explosion and fire.

A NSW Ambulance spokesperson confirmed that paramedics had taken a man in his 30s to Liverpool Hospital for further treatment.

NSW Police confirmed the explosion, fire and injuries to the man are being treated as a workplace incident and they will not be investigating.

SafeWork NSW have been contacted for comment.
